【JSマスター #12】現役エンジニアが教える!実践JavaScript入門 〜ブラウザ上でのデータの保存 Web Storage編〜

ブラウザ ローカル ストレージ

Local Storage ペインとコンソールを使用して localStorage キーと値のペアを表示および編集する方法。 ローカル ストレージの表示と編集 - Microsoft Edge Developer documentation | Microsoft Learn ローカルストレージとは、データをブラウザ側に蓄積する仕組みである。 保存時に、サイトごとにKeyと文字の組み合わせでデータを格納する。 サイトごとの領域は、それぞれ独立しており、別のサイトで記録したデータを操作することはできない。 また、それぞれのサイト毎に保存できる上限は制限されている。 その具体的サイズはブラウザ毎にことなる。 詳細な仕様は下記を参照のこと。 https://html.spec.whatwg.org/multipage/webstorage.html#the-localstorage-attribute. 実装例. 下記にローカルストレージの実装例を紹介する。 localStorage APIの使用例. localStorageの操作を行うAPIの使用例を紹介する。 Local Storage. ローカルストレージは、ブラウザにデータを永続的に保存するための仕組みです。. ローカルストレージに保存されたデータは、ページの再読み込みやブラウザの再起動後も保持されます。. ローカルストレージは、キーと値のペアで localStrageの上限容量は大抵のブラウザでは5MBですが、ブラウザによっては10MBだったり4MBだったりします。 Cookieに比べると多くの容量が許容されているとはいえ、無制限に使えるわけではない点は注意が必要です。 ローカルストレージ は、クライアント、つまりユーザーのコンピュータにデータを保存するためのHTML5ウェブストレージオブジェクトです。 ローカルに保存されたデータには有効期限がなく、削除されるまで存在し続けます。 (これに対して、もう一つのHTML5ウェブストレージAPIであるセッションストレージは、ブラウザが閉じたときに保存されたデータを削除します) ローカルストレージは純粋なJavaScriptです。 同様に、ユーザーのデバイス上にプレーンテキストのドキュメントを生成することに変わりはありませんが、ローカルストレージでは(cookieの4KBに対して)最大5MBのデータを保存することができます。 |tfa| qrq| kbu| hcs| wjc| xgj| flj| bmd| pny| dws| axq| blb| ilg| ouy| fwt| yno| cob| fvl| upz| nyr| wlr| lor| tbt| zrw| nes| woo| tes| vxd| aqi| nnk| nbm| tij| omd| zox| aoq| dnd| lje| mog| oym| sry| snv| unj| ltu| enh| pfe| ntq| pvo| lqr| fgv| isl|